To understand heart failure, it helps to know how the heart works. The right side of your heart gets oxygen-low blood from your body. It pumps the blood to your lungs to pick up oxygen.

RIGHT AND LEFT SIDED HEART FAILURE • Right sided heart failure is characterised by the presence of peripheral edema, raised JVP and hypotension and congestive hepatomegaly. • Left sided heart failure – pulmonary edema is the striking feature. You can also reduce your risk of heart failure by avoiding lifestyle factors that place added stress on your heart, such as: WebRight heart failure may occur alone but is usually a result of left-sided failure. When the left ventricle fails, fluid backs up in the lungs. In turn, pressure from excess fluid can damage the heart's right side as it works to pump blood into the lungs.
